The Beat Goes On: KC & The Sunshine Band's Musical Journey

Founded in 1973 in Miami, Florida, KC & The Sunshine Band pioneered a sound that walked a fine line between funk, R&B, and disco. They surged to popularity in a time where music was undergoing a massive evolution, and they have thrived by adapting and evolving while staying true to their roots.
